**Installation:** Extract the ZIP to your SPT-AKI installation folder. To fix hover tooltip not refreshing when an item's price or interested traders have changed while the item's inspection window is still open, use the "[Item Attribute Fix](https://hub.sp-tarkov.com/files/file/1232-item-attribute-fix/)" companion mod. **Description:** A client-side mod that uses the game's built-in methods to show the highest selling price offer from traders, exactly as displayed in the selling UI. Hovering over the attribute will reveal available offers from all traders who can buy this item, sorted from highest to lowest. This can be highly "educational" for the purpose of learning the value of items within Tarkov. This mod is very easy to update as it gets all of the content from the game itself (list of traders, currency rates, currency symbols, etc.) Note: Flea market prices are not included intentionally, because they are ridiculous and completely break the balance and any kind of challenge in getting rich, due to how likely you are to sell a useless item for a meme price in SPT. Example: "Molot AKM-type gas tube" is over ₽350,000 on SPT's flea market. In EFT, no one will actually buy this, but due to how flea market works in SPT, you are very likely to successfully sell it. This is a poorly thought-out feature and I rather pretend it didn't exist (at least for selling purposes). Due to using the game's built-in methods, this mod is dynamic: ![](https://i.imgur.com/I0dcnVx.png) It is container content aware: ![](https://i.imgur.com/Ncx0tw7.png) It is condition aware: ![](https://i.imgur.com/9B71uL9.png) And, of course, durability and currency rates aware: ![](https://i.imgur.com/h4oMG3m.png) And also stack count aware: ![](https://i.imgur.com/tA5EETE.png)

**Installation:** Extract the ZIP to your SPT-AKI installation folder. To fix hover tooltip not refreshing when ammo has been added/removed while the item's inspection window is still open, use the "[Item Attribute Fix](https://hub.sp-tarkov.com/files/file/1232-item-attribute-fix/)" companion mod. **Description:** A client-side mod that replaces the "Max Count" attribute of magazines with "Loaded Ammo", localized to other languages as well. Hovering over the attribute will reveal all ammo types and their count from top to bottom. The mod integrates neatly within the game's world without exposing more information than the PMC/Scav's "Mag Drills" skill allows. So, you can do this without restrictions when outside of raid: ![](https://i.imgur.com/sxDeiok.png) But while in a raid, only a full (and checked) or completely empty magazine is fully revealed: ![](https://i.imgur.com/VuDZ2eL.png) And once you shoot and your magazine is no longer in "checked" state, you'll need to check it again: ![](https://i.imgur.com/m433oVD.png) And once checked, you will see the ammo types in the stack, but the count will only be shown if an exact count is known (e.g. if your "Mag Drills" skill is high enough): ![](https://i.imgur.com/ooKsVaJ.png)

**Installation:** Extract the ZIP to your SPT-AKI installation folder. Note: This mod depends on my "[Custom Interactions](https://hub.sp-tarkov.com/files/file/1278-custom-interactions/)" library. **Description:** Currently included custom context menu items: \* "**Firing mode**" for weapons. \* "**Active scope**", "**Active mode**" (incl. zoom) and "**Zero distance**" for sights. \* "**Turn on/off**" and "**Active mode**" for tactical devices. Note: Auxillary scopes and sight/tactical modes have no names in the game, just an index. You can change the context menu scaling from the mod's settings. If you have an idea of a useful menu item that should be added, let me know in the comments. Only no-nonsense ideas will be considered. **Important**: The game does not have a facility for saving any of these interactions to your server-side profile directly because they are literally impossible to do outside of raid. That will require a custom server-side solution I may include in a later version. If you use any of these interactions outside of raid, they will persist as long as the game is running, but will be saved server-side only when you enter a raid and then extract from it, with those items being in your gear. A few screenshots: ![](https://i.imgur.com/ikxxkZ9.png) ![](https://i.imgur.com/qOzuCCu.png) ![](https://i.imgur.com/71pJRw2.png) ![](https://i.imgur.com/6OaXNby.png)

**Installation:** Extract the ZIP to your SPT-AKI installation folder. Note: You must delete Faupi's Munitions Expert, as it will directly conflict with this mod. **Description:** This mod started as a fork of [Faupi's Munitions Expert](https://hub.sp-tarkov.com/files/file/554-faupi-munitions-expert/) and then rewritten as exclusively a client-side mod. It adds additional attributes revealing the hidden stats of all types of ammo: ![](https://i.imgur.com/M1HAlpu.png) Optionally, the background colors are replaced with custom colors (not included with the base game) according to penetration power value, and are based on the visible light spectrum (reversed, because it looks better)\*: ![](https://i.imgur.com/MDZo0Ne.png) \* The colors can be customized from the mod's settings. \* In most cases, low penetration means high flesh damage, while high penetration means low flesh damage, but there are a few exceptions where there's both high penetration and high flesh damage (rare end-game ammo). And here's a preview: ![](https://i.imgur.com/buxxt2b.png) ![](https://i.imgur.com/4rpfYvQ.png) ![](https://i.imgur.com/2EbmcAl.png)
